In this episode of Riding Unicorns, we’re joined by Carles Reina, Go-to-Market Lead at ElevenLabs, an AI Audio research and deployment company that tripled it's valuation to $3.3BN in January, after confirming a new $180M funding round.

From starting out as a banker in Barcelona to scaling Uber’s first European team, and now investing in over 70 startups, Carles shares the hard-won lessons that drive startup success.

We dive into:

🔄 Career pivot: Leaving banking for Uber at 20 people and discovering the thrill of early-stage impact
📈 Building GTM from scratch: Lessons from Tractable & ElevenLabs—experimenting on ICPs, pricing, and pitches
💼 Angel investing playbook: How to break in as an operator-investor, source top deals, and add value beyond capital
🗣 Voice AI’s inflection point: Why high-quality speech models are the next frontier, and how ElevenLabs powers voice notes for surgery prep and on-demand customer support
🤖 Robotics meets LLMs: The “GPT moment” in hardware, investing in companies merging industrial robotics with large language models
✂️ Trimming strategies: Locking in gains (10–20%) at Series B/C while staying exposed to upside
🌐 Scaling globally: Personalizing GTM across the US, Europe, Asia, and beyond
